Unlocking the Keys of Oil Painting



Open the keys of oil painting and discover a rich and classic tool that has captured the creative imagination of artists for centuries. Oil painting includes using pigments put on hold in drying oils, typically linseed oil. This versatile tool allows for blending shades, developing abundant textures, and attaining luminous results that can't be quickly replicated with other sorts of paint.

To start your oil painting trip, you'll require high quality oil paints, brushes appropriate for oil painting, a palette for blending shades, and a surface to repaint on, such as canvas or wood. Unlike acrylics, oil paints have a sluggish drying time, permitting higher flexibility in mixing and layering shades. This characteristic also makes it possible for musicians to work with a piece over an extensive duration, making modifications and improvements as they go.

When working with oils, remember to clean your brushes with solvent and make use of a well-ventilated room as a result of the fumes. Experiment with different techniques like alla prima (wet-on-wet) or glazing to achieve diverse effects and unleash your creative thinking with this traditional painting tool.
